corect me if I'm wrong but in the OCG ruling every time he would be destroyed you can bring him back with 1000 more ATK each time he is destroyed

 

Do you have a link for that ruling? I don't think it's ever been that way...in my understanding, when a monster with an ATK buff hits the GY, the ATK is reset to whatever is on the card. Therefore, every time this card hits the GY, it goes back to 1000. Now, you could add a line in the effect that says it gains 1000 more ATK than when it was destroyed, but I don't think that's the way the ruling goes.
